flag Bangladesh struggles with high stillbirths and child mortality, needing significant healthcare improvements.

flag Bangladesh faces high rates of stillbirths and child mortality, with over 100,000 children dying before age five each year, mostly within the first month. flag The country has the highest stillbirth rate in South Asia, with one in 41 births ending in stillbirth. flag Home births without skilled medical help and lack of access to specialized care for newborns are key issues. flag To meet UN goals, Bangladesh needs to save an additional 28,000 newborns annually, requiring more trained midwives and improved healthcare facilities.
